जब तक कि आप एक कंप्यूटर वैज्ञानिक नहीं हैं, तब तक यह "पोस्टस्क्रिप्ट" को देखने में भ्रमित हो सकता है और यह जान सकता है कि यह आपके पास "सहकारी प्रोग्रामिंग भाषा" है और भी अधिक उलझन में शब्दों को देखने के लिए। आज, हम इसे आसान बना देंगे, और पोस्टस्क्रिप्ट को संदर्भ में रखेंगे, समझाएंगे कि यह क्या है, यह क्यों और कैसे करता है, और यह कैसे अपने ग्राफिक दुनिया को अपने सामूहिक कान पर बदल देता है! पढ़ना जारी रखें, आगे कुछ अच्छी geeky मजेदार सामान है।
एएससीआईआई, डॉट मैट्रिक्स, प्लॉटर्स, और प्रिंटिंग ग्राफिक्स बदलना
हाउ-टू गीक में हम में से कुछ लोग खुद को डेट कर सकते हैं और कह सकते हैं कि हमें प्रिंटर विकास में एक महत्वपूर्ण अगला कदम याद है-डॉट मैट्रिक्स प्रिंटर। ये पिक्सल की पंक्तियों के साथ-साथ अवरुद्ध, कम पिक्सेल गहराई टाइपोग्राफी के साथ कुछ कच्चे ग्रेस्केल ग्राफिक्स को प्रिंट करने में सक्षम थे। हालांकि उन्हें डिजिटल छवियों (हालांकि ASCII कला प्रकार की गणना) बनाने का लाभ मिला था, लेकिन क्रूड टाइपोग्राफी प्रारंभिक डॉट मैट्रिक्स प्रिंटर के लिए एक झटका था। सभी डॉट मैट्रिक्स प्रिंटरों ने लगभग उसी तरह प्रिंटिंग छवियों और पाठ पर दिशानिर्देश लिया; इसे पिक्सल में तोड़ दें, उन्हें पंक्तियों में प्रिंट करें क्योंकि प्रिंट हेड पेपर के साथ गुजरता है, कागज के अगले हिस्से को खिलाता है, और दोहराता है।
डॉट मैट्रिक्स प्रिंटर के विपरीत, षड्यंत्रकारियों विशेष रूप से विनिर्माण में अभी भी काफी आम हैं। Plotters एक स्टाइलस या चाकू ब्लेड के साथ चिकनी, गणितीय शुद्ध वेक्टर आकार खींचने, मुद्रित करने, या कटौती करने के लिए बीजगणितीय निर्देशांक पर चारों ओर कागजात, विनाइल, या विभिन्न अन्य सामग्री ले जाएँ। जैसा कि हमने सीखा है, टाइपोग्राफिक ग्लाइफ की प्रकृति के कारण, वेक्टर आकार, सार में परिभाषित अमूर्त, गणितीय शुद्ध आकार को परिभाषित करने के लिए पिक्सेल से काफी बेहतर होते हैं। चूंकि प्लॉटर्स को सटीक गणित के आधार पर चारों ओर स्थानांतरित करने के लिए इंजीनियर किया जाता है, इसलिए टाइपोग्राफी और अन्य आकारों को बनाने के निर्देशों को पीसी के लिए डिवाइस से संवाद करने के लिए काफी आसान है।
चुनौती यह थी: तकनीक प्रिंट करने के लिए पीसी का कोई मौजूदा मॉडल एक ही समय में वेक्टर-आधारित, स्वच्छ टाइपोग्राफी और ग्राफिक्स बना सकता है। क्या करने वाले सभी चतुर गीक क्या थे?
जेरोक्स पीआरसी, और प्रथम लेजर प्रिंटर का विकास
द बेस्ट ऑफ द वर्ल्ड: पोस्टस्क्रिप्ट प्रिंट व्हाइस्पीर है
पोस्टस्क्रिप्ट, नाम के प्रकार के सुझाव के रूप में, वास्तव में एक ट्यूरिंग-पूर्ण प्रोग्रामिंग भाषा है। निर्देश मानव-पठनीय तरीके से लिखे गए हैं, और प्रिंटर को सूचित किया गया है, जो निर्देशों से उच्च गुणवत्ता वाली कला बनाता है। Inkguides.com से नमूना "हैलो वर्ल्ड" प्रोग्राम यहां दिया गया है।
%!PS /inch {72 mul} def /Times-Roman findfont 50 scalefont setfont 2.5 inch 5 inch moveto (Hello, World!) show showpage
हम बहुत जल्दी से देखना शुरू करते हैं कि किस प्रकार के निर्देश प्रिंटर प्रिंटर दे रहे हैं, और दिशानिर्देश कितने सरल हैं। इस कार्यक्रम में संदर्भित फ़ॉन्ट वेक्टर फॉर्म में मौजूद हैं और उन्हें अलग-अलग फाइलों से बुलाया जाता है- और डिजिटल ग्राफिक्स उद्योग में एडोब के योगदान का एक बड़ा हिस्सा थे। पोस्टस्क्रिप्ट पर मिक्कल मीनाइक नील्सन के पृष्ठ से दूसरा उदाहरण यहां दिया गया है:
%! /Times-Roman findfont 16 scalefont setfont gsave %save before using translate 105 210 translate %This cordinates places the images on %the page %-----The actual image begin------- 76.8 86.4 scale 40 45 1 [ 40 0 0 -45 0 45 ] { < fffff5ffffffffdeffffffffeaffffffffdeffffffffffffffffffeeffff fffffefffffffffbffffffffffffffffffccffffffff77bffffffeffdfff fffdfff7fffffbfff7fffff77ffbffff5ebfbdfffafdbf7ebffbf3ff6fdf e9ef7ff7f3d6bfff7d55afff7efffafffffffffcffff7efffffffef7ffff fffdf77fffffffeffffffffdf7bffffffbd7bfffffffbffffffff7fbbfff ffef7bffffffeefbdfffffdef7bfffffffffbfffffbdefffffff7dff7fff ff7bdffffffff7ff7ffff977e57ffffa5ffbffffff7feebffffdbff4bfff ff7fffffffffffffffffffffffffff> } image %-----The actual image end ------- grestore %restore the settings from before the translat 0 245 moveto (Text and image, ) show 0 229 moveto (side by side. ) show showpage
Gobbledygook का यह बड़ा मध्य भाग वास्तव में हेक्साडेसिमल कोड है जो एक छवि को परिभाषित करता है। अधिकांश पोस्टस्क्रिप्ट इस तरह हाथ से नहीं लिखी जाती है, बल्कि कार्यक्रमों द्वारा। यह पोस्टस्क्रिप्ट कोड वास्तव में कैसा दिखता है, इस बारे में एक विचार प्राप्त करने के लिए, इस कोड से उत्पन्न छवि के नीचे मिक्कल के पृष्ठ से इस स्क्रीनकैप पर नज़र डालें। संपूर्ण फोटोग्राफिक mages को इस तरह पोस्टस्क्रिप्ट के रूप में फिर से लिखा जा सकता है- फ़ाइल प्रकार को Encapsulated Post Script, या EPS कहा जाता है।
आधुनिक मुद्रित पेज और नई प्रिंटिंग प्रक्रियाएं
आजकल, सभी प्रिंटर पोस्टस्क्रिप्ट का उपयोग नहीं करते हैं, लेकिन उनमें से सभी को पाठ और छवि डेटा को मुद्रित सामग्री में बदलने के लिए किसी प्रकार की अनुवाद परत होनी चाहिए। हम आमतौर पर इन कार्यक्रमों को बुलाते हैं प्रिंटर ड्राइवरऔर आजकल वे निर्माता से आते हैं, और एक मालिकाना सॉफ्टवेयर हैं। कुछ रूपों या फैशन में, यह एक महत्वपूर्ण टुकड़ा है कि सभी प्रिंटर को पीसी के साथ संवाद करने की आवश्यकता होती है-भले ही हमारे घरों में उपयोग किए जाने वाले प्रिंटर पहले लेजर प्रिंटर की तुलना में बहुत अलग समस्याएं हल कर रहे हों। भले ही, पोस्टस्क्रिप्ट एडोब की पहली बड़ी सफलता थी, और यह प्रभावी रूप से शुरू होने का हिस्सा है ग्राफिक्स और डिजाइन के विश्वव्यापी लोकप्रिय विस्फोट.
छवि क्रेडिट: क्रिएटिव कॉमन्स के तहत उपलब्ध जंग-नाम नाम द्वारा भाई प्रिंटर एमएफसी -8370। क्रिएटिव कॉमन्स के तहत उपलब्ध एंडी ब्रूमफील्ड द्वारा प्राचीन डॉट मैट्रिक्स प्रिंटर। आईबीएम 3800, फोटोग्राफर अज्ञात, उचित उपयोग माना जाता है। जीएनयू लाइसेंस के तहत उपलब्ध Yzmo द्वारा जेरोोग्राफिक फोटोकॉपी प्रक्रिया। क्रिएटिव कॉमन्स के तहत उपलब्ध सात ब्लॉक द्वारा एडोब सॉफ्टवेयर। क्रिएटिव कॉमन्स के तहत उपलब्ध एरिन स्पर्लिंग द्वारा नया प्रिंटर।